DUSSELL v. KAUFMAN CONSTRU. CO., INC.

No. 172.

10 Pa. D. & C. 2d 505 (1957)

Dussell v. Kaufman Construction Co., Inc.

Common Pleas Court of Philadelphia County, Pennsylvania.

June 11, 1957.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Klovsky & Kuby, for plaintiffs.

Swartz, Campbell & Henry, for defendants.


HAGAN, J., June 11, 1957.

Plaintiffs are property owners who aver in their complaint in trespass that defendant negligently damaged their property while it was in the course of constructing a road. Defendant filed preliminary objections to the complaint in the nature of a motion for more specific pleadings.
